Packed and ready to go




We packed up Yoshi last night, so all we had to do was get in the car this morning and go.

We decided a couple of days ago that today was going to be the longest stretch, we needed to get to Albuquerque the first day so that we could make it to The Dragon by Wed.

We hit the road around 6:15 and headed out, we also decided that we did not want to get any kind of tickets on this trip and that at the most we would only drive 10 MPH over the speed limit. Luckily we actually stuck to this, because we counted 25 police cars either giving tickets out or waiting to give tickets. Our handy Passport Escort 8500 helped us, but we were pretty safe cuz we weren't driving much over the speed limit anyway.

Can you believe that we drove over 730 miles and we only saw 3 other MINI's? I wonder where all the MINI's were? Well we got to Albuquerque around 7:30 and we figured we averaged 29.3 mpg, not too bad considering the car is packed with alot of extra weight, plus the extra drag from the rooftop mounted storage pod.

Tomorrow we will head to Oaklahoma City..
